Summary
Amends the Illinois Governmental Ethics Act. Requires members of the General Assembly and candidates for nomination or election to the General Assembly to make a statement of economic interests concerning any client or entity related to the legalized marijuana industry with whom the person making the statement, or his or her spouse or immediate family member living with that person, maintains an economic association and from which he or she has derived any economic benefit other than the salary received as a member of the General Assembly during the preceding calendar year. Makes a conforming modification to the statement of economic interests disclosure form to be filed with the Secretary of State.
